IBM Z JCL-Experte

Stellen Sie Anwendungen effizienter und effektiver bereit, indem Sie JCL-(Job Control Language-)Fehler korrigieren und Codierungsstandards validieren.

IBM Z JCL Expert ist ein JCL-Prüftool zur Validierung der Syntax von JCL-Anweisungen, -Prozeduren und -Jobs in der bereits verwendeten Entwicklungsumgebung.

Das IBM Z JCL Expert-Tool bietet eine erweiterte JCL-Prüfung, einschließlich der Überprüfung der Konformität mit dem Standortstandard, indem die Syntax der JCL- und Dienstprogrammparameter online überprüft wird. Im Gegensatz zu anderen Angeboten führt IBM Z JCL Expert die JCL-Prüfung in der bestehenden Entwicklungsumgebung durch. 

Es bietet eine Batch-Schnittstelle zur gleichzeitigen Prüfung mehrerer JCLs, ohne dass dies Auswirkungen auf die Service-Level-Verpflichtungen hat. Im Gegensatz zu anderen Angeboten bietet IBM Z JCL Expert eine REST-Schnittstelle zur Automatisierung der JCL-Prüfung und integriert sie in automatisierte IT-Prozesse. 

Neuerungen

Aktualisierungen und Erweiterungen der Funktionen für IBM Z JCL Expert

Forschung von The Future Group Entwicklung von Workload Automation Lesen Sie das Infoblatt, das in Zusammenarbeit mit IBM und 21st Century erstellt wurde, um die Bewertung des gesamten Marktes für Batch-Scheduling und -Programmierung durch The Future Group zu erfahren. Es bietet Einblicke in IBM JCL Expert und warum es gut geeignet ist, um die Anforderungen des Kunden in der sich ständig verändernden DevOps-Landschaft zu erfüllen. Infoblatt herunterladen
Vorteile Fachwissen zur Erstellung und Wartung von JCL

Überprüfen Sie JCL schnell vor der Ausführung und beschleunigen Sie die Testzeit in den vorhandenen Entwicklungsumgebungen.

Reduzierte Verarbeitungsverzögerungen oder verpasste SLAs

Identifizieren und korrigieren Sie JCL-Fehler, bevor sie dem Scheduler zur Ausführung hinzugefügt werden, um Ausführungszeitfehler und Verarbeitungsverzögerungen zu vermeiden.

Überprüfung der JCL-Korrektheit und -Konformität

Validieren Sie die JCL-Codierungsstandards vor Ort, um Fehler zu reduzieren und die Problemdiagnose nach Massenaktualisierungen aufgrund von Workload-Verschiebungen oder -Zusammenführungen zu vereinfachen.

Funktionen
Steueranweisungen zur Syntaxprüfung

Überprüfen Sie die Syntax von JCL- und Dienstprogramm-Parametern, um sicherzustellen, dass die Anwendungsverarbeitung Unterbrechungen und Verzögerungen aufgrund von JCL-Fehlern reduziert hat.


Triggert die JCL-Prüfung und den Ausgabeempfang

Verbessern Sie die Fähigkeiten eines Entwicklers auf vorhandenen, vertrauten Testplattformen, um Anwendungscode schneller zu testen und für die Verwendung bereitzustellen.


Unkompliziertes Programm zur Verwaltung von Standortregeln

Integrieren Sie das benutzerdefinierte Programm, das die standortspezifischen JCL-Standards validiert, in den automatisierten Workflow, um sicherzustellen, dass die Mitarbeiter die vom Unternehmen geforderten Richtlinien einheitlich und genau anwenden.


Sicherheitsüberprüfungen

Überprüfen Sie, ob der Absender einer JCL-Prüfung oder eine andere Benutzer-ID über den erforderlichen Zugriff auf die in der JCL definierten Datensätze verfügt und dass Db2, sofern es in der JCL verwendet wird, READ-Zugriff auf alle in der JCLLIB definierten Datensätze hat.


Vorhandensein von referenzierten Objekten

Überprüfen Sie das Vorhandensein und die Verfügbarkeit von Datensätzen und Db2-Plänen, die in der JCL verwendet werden, um sicherzustellen, dass die Anwendungsverarbeitung weniger Unterbrechungen und Verzögerungen aufgrund von JCL-Fehlern aufweist.


Einfache Integration in eine DevOps-Pipeline

Verbessern Sie die Fähigkeiten eines DevOps-Technikers, um den JCL-Prüfungsschritt über die verfügbaren CLI-Schnittstellen in einen DevOps-Pipeline-Prozess zu integrieren.

Funktionsweise Reduzieren Sie die DevOps-Bereitstellungszeit 

IBM Z JCL Expert wurde entwickelt, um die JCL- und Parametersyntax während des Testens zu validieren und zu korrigieren und so den Prozess der Bereitstellung neuer Anwendungen und Funktionen zu beschleunigen.

Reduzieren Sie Verzögerungen bei der kritischen Stapelverarbeitung

Syntaxfehler, fehlende Autorisierungen, nicht vorhandene Datensätze oder inaktive Db2-Pläne gehören mit der Möglichkeit, mehrere JCL-Prozeduren über verschiedene logische Partitionen (LPARs) hinweg zu validieren und zu formatieren, möglicherweise der Vergangenheit an.

Verkürzung der Zeit für die Validierung von JCL-Massenänderungen

Die Migration des Schedulers, die Verlagerung des Workloads und die Übernahme oder Fusion des Unternehmens erfordern möglicherweise eine Validierung der JCL-Streams für Massenaktualisierungen, was mit diesem Tool möglich ist.

Anwendungsfälle JCL Expert unterstützt die folgenden Nutzungsszenarien.

Anwendungsentwickler oder Systemprogrammierer, der JCL über ISPF Edit schreibt oder ändert.

Produktionssteuerungsanalyst, der JCL vor oder nach der Änderung über die Batch-Schnittstelle überprüft.

Ein Produktionssteuerungsanalyst überprüft JCL, bevor er die Ausführung des Auftrags über die Batch-Schnittstelle plant.

Produktionssteuerungsanalyst, der versucht, eine fehlerhafte JCL über ISPF Edit zu beheben.

Produktionssteuerungsanalyst, der IZWS-Variablen auflösen muss, bevor er JCL zu einem Plan in IZWS hinzufügt.

Systemprogrammierer, der standortspezifische JCL-Standards durch die automatische Ausführung eines Standortregelprogramms implementiert.

Verwendung automatisierter Tools zur Validierung von JCL über die REST-API.

JCL-Validierung von Remote-Workstations mit dem Eclipse-Plug-in.

DevOps-Ingenieur nutzt das Zowe CLI-Plug-in von einer Workstation, um JCL-Schritte zu validieren und gleichzeitig eine komplexe Build-Pipeline zu entwickeln, die mit z/OS verbunden ist.

Technische Details
Systemvoraussetzungen

JCL Expert hat die folgenden Systemanforderungen:

  • z/OS 2.4, 2.5 oder 3.1 (JCL Expert ist nicht mit früheren Versionen von z/OS kompatibel)
  • JES2 (JCL Expert ist nicht mit JES3 kompatibel)
  • REXX Compiler oder Alternate Compiler Runtime zum Ausführen des ISPF Edit-Makros
Alle Systemanforderungen ansehen
Weiterführende Produkte IBM Developer for z/OS

Bietet ein modernes Toolset für die Entwicklung und Wartung von IBM z/OS-Anwendungen durch den Einsatz von DevOps-Praktiken, um mehr, schneller und mit höherer Qualität bereitzustellen.

IBM Z Workload Scheduler

Verwaltet und automatisiert Datenverarbeitungsvorgänge, um Produktions-Workloads auf der Grundlage der in den Anwendungsbeschreibungen bereitgestellten Informationen zu planen und automatisch zu terminieren.

Entdecken Sie weitere DevOps for IBM Z-Produkte
Nächste Schritte

Entdecken Sie IBM Z JCL Expert. Planen Sie ein kostenfreies 30-minütiges Meeting mit einem IBM Z Ansprechpartner.

Weitere Informationsmöglichkeiten Dokumentation Support IBM Redbooks Support und Services Global Financing Flexible Preisstruktur Schulung und Training Community Entwicklungscommunity Business Partner Ressourcen